Hackney Central to Bexley by train

A train trip from Hackney Central to Bexley takes about 1hrs 32 mins on average, covering roughly 11 miles (18 kilometres). With around 117 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£9.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Amenities

Hackney Central is well-equipped to meet the needs of its passengers. Ticket machines are available and accessible, and you can effortlessly collect tickets purchased online at these machines. While smartcards aren't issued here, you'll still find it easy to navigate your way around. The station is also designed with accessibility in mind. Partial step-free access is available, with specific provisions such as wheelchair-accessible ticket machines, ramps for train access, and customer help points to assist travelers with any queries or special needs. Although there are no accessible toilets or luggage storage, the station ensures safety with the presence of CCTV.

Although Hackney Central lacks refreshment facilities and shopping options within the station, the neighboring area is rich with cafes, restaurants, and local shops eager to serve up a taste of East London's unique flair. And if you're ever in need of some help, the staff are available at the ticket office and through the help point for assistance. However, for those looking for a bit of down-time before their next train, note that there is no seating area or first-class lounge but waiting rooms are open for use during the station's operating times.

Onward Travel Options

Continuing your journey from Hackney Central is a breeze thanks to its excellent transport connections. For eastbound services to Stratford, head to Bus Stop T on Amhurst Road. Westbound travelers aiming for Camden Road can catch services from Bus Stop K on the same street. While there are no dedicated taxi ranks immediately accessible, various private hire options can be easily arranged via phone or app-based services. Cyclists are also welcomed, with 16 bicycle spaces available, though these are not sheltered.

Facilities and Amenities at Bexley Station

Step into Bexley Station and find convenience at every corner. The ticket office opens early at 6:10 AM on weekdays and Saturdays (and slightly later at 8:10 AM on Sundays), closing at 7:30 PM and 3:40 PM respectively, ensuring you have ample time to secure travel essentials. In the mood for a quiet coffee while waiting for your train? Head over to the coffee kiosk or vending machines available for refreshments. Though the station lacks an ATM, induction loops, smartcard validators, and accessible ticket machines are strategically placed for your ease of use.

If you require assistance, Bexley Station doesn't disappoint. With customer help points and staffed service till late evening on most days, help is only a request away. For those needing step-free access, the station accommodates well; the entire premises provide step-free access to both platforms and the booking hall. There are secure accreditations in place, and CCTV is operational, ensuring a safe surrounding for peace of mind.
